The Role:

A focal point for Egis's strategic growth lies in the Building Engineering market. Egis has made a name for itself throughout the world in part because of extensive building design capabilities and experience. Our established presence in many major cities in Canada, client contacts in the real estate market related to building facilities and other services, complemented by an extensive pool of international technical experts positions us perfectly to become a prominent player in the building design sector in North America.

We are actively seeking an experienced business leader with substantial North American building design and leadership experience, located in a major North American city, to spearhead this growth. In the role of Vice President, you will join a collaborative leadership team comprised of seasoned professionals, all deeply committed to ensuring your success. This presents a unique opportunity to play a pivotal role in Egis's growth, contributing to the exciting expansion of this service the region.

The ideal candidate will have the following background, skills and attributes:

  • Extensive experience working in the building design space in North America.
  • Knowledge of the North American buildings market including private and public procurement practices. In particular, knowledge of the Industrial or Healthcare markets.
  • 20 years of experience in building design, business development and project delivery, with a minimum of 10 years in a leadership role.
  • Strong business development skills, including a current network of contacts.
  • Proven track record of growing business and a desire to do it again.
  • Strategic mindset, big picture thinker and solid problem-solving skills.
  • Strong leadership skills.
  • Superior business and financial acumen.

Job Duties:

As Vice President, you will work closely with the senior leadership team and will be responsible for providing direct leadership, strategic direction and day-to-day management to the division. You will also be a key member of the strategic leadership team of the region and will work with the leadership team on the overall strategy and vision of the region.

The initial focus of this role will business development as we further establish ourselves as a leader in the building design space in North America.

Specific Responsibilities Include:

Marketing/Business Development

  • Identify and secure building engineering clients in major North American cities.
  • Actively participate in the strategic development and pursuit of clients and projects.
  • Provide visible leadership with potential clients and existing clients.
  • Maintain regular dialogue with key clients.
  • Participate in the development and execution of key project and client presentations.
  • Develop and maintain relationships with industry professionals, consultants and other business leaders.

Strategic Planning

  • Actively lead and support the execution of the strategic plan within the group and work with managers to develop and implement operational plans that ensure targets are being met.
  • As a member of the strategic leadership team for the region, contribute to the development of the strategic planning process.

Leadership

  • Lead and direct the divisional leadership and their teams.
  • Provide coaching and development to the managers.
  • Actively lead and support a positive, respectful and results oriented work environment and ensures consistency with core values.
  • As required, prepare and presents reports to internal stakeholders on areas that fall within the scope or mandate of the role.

Operational Management

  • Provide high level guidance and oversight in the preparation of proposals, development of work plans, schedules, budgets, fee proposal and negotiations. Work closely with the managers to monitor progress on all projects to ensure timeline and targets on being met.
  • Ensure quality processes are in place for all business units specific to their requirements.
  • Provide guidance to managers on employee matters and monitors the completion of performance reviews for all employees within the group.
